The Nutritional Architecture of Broccoli
To understand why broccoli crisps have captured the attention of nutritionists and food scientists, one must first look at the raw material. Broccoli ($Brassica \: oleracea$) is a nutritional powerhouse, packed with essential vitamins, minerals, and bioactive compounds. When converted into a crispy snack, the goal is to retain as much of this matrix as possible.
Macronutrients and Micronutrients
Broccoli is naturally low in calories and carbohydrates but rich in dietary fiber. It is an exceptional source of Vitamin C, Vitamin K1, folate (Vitamin B9), potassium, manganese, and iron. Unlike traditional potato chips, which are carbohydrate-dense and strip away the potato's skin (where much of the fiber resides), chips made genuinely from broccoli maintain a high fiber-to-carb ratio.
Bioactive Compounds and Antioxidants
What truly sets broccoli apart from other snack bases is its concentration of glucosinolates. When disrupted by chewing or chopping, glucosinolates break down into isothiocyanates, most notably sulforaphane. Research consistently suggests that sulforaphane plays a vital role in cellular defense, reducing oxidative stress, and supporting metabolic health.
Furthermore, broccoli contains significant amounts of:
Lutein and Zeaxanthin: Carotenoids that are crucial for ocular health and protecting eyes from oxidative damage.
Kaempferol: A flavonoid with potent anti-inflammatory properties that may reduce the risk of chronic diseases.
Deconstructing the Market: Commercial Varieties
When browsing the grocery store shelves, consumers will encounter several distinct products labeled as broccoli crisps. However, their structural composition and nutritional profiles vary drastically based on how they are manufactured.
To help consumers navigate the marketplace, the following table deconstructs the three primary categories of commercially available broccoli crisps:
| Attribute | Vacuum-Fried / Dehydrated Florets | Extruded Broccoli Puffs / Chips | Baked Veggie Flakes / Crisps |
| Primary Ingredient | Whole broccoli florets (85-95%) | Rice flour, corn flour, or potato starch | Broccoli puree or powder mixed with seeds/grains |
| Broccoli Content | Extremely High | Low to Moderate (often <10% powder) | Moderate (30-50%) |
| Texture Profile | Light, airy, porous, retaining floret shape | Crunchy, uniform, melt-in-the-mouth | Dense, cracker-like, hearty crunch |
| Processing Method | Low-temperature vacuum frying or dehydration | High-temperature, high-pressure extrusion | Traditional baking |
| Oil Content | Low to Moderate (typically avocado or rice bran oil) | Variable (often contains refined vegetable oils) | Minimal (usually cold-pressed oils) |
| Best For | Whole-food purists, low-carb diets, fiber intake | Toddler snacks, replacing traditional potato chips | Dipping in hummus, charcuterie boards |
Manufacturing Technology: From Field to Foil Pouch
The creation of a shelf-stable, genuinely crunchy broccoli crisp requires sophisticated food engineering. Standard deep-frying methods used for potato chips fail when applied to green vegetables; the high heat ($170^\circ\text{C}$ to $190^\circ\text{C}$) rapidly degrades chlorophyll, turning the product an unappetizing brown, while destroying volatile vitamins like Vitamin C and converting beneficial compounds into acrolein.
To bypass these limitations, commercial manufacturers primarily utilize two advanced technologies:
1. Vacuum Frying Technology
Vacuum frying is a revolutionary preservation method conducted in a closed system under sub-atmospheric pressure (usually below $10\text{ kPa}$). By lowering the pressure, the boiling point of water inside the broccoli florets drops significantly, sometimes to as low as $40^\circ\text{C}$ to $60^\circ\text{C}$.
- The Process: Fresh broccoli is washed, cut into uniform florets, blanched to inactivate enzymes, and quickly frozen. The frozen florets are placed into the vacuum fryer chamber. Because water evaporates at a lower temperature, the broccoli crisps dry out and become crunchy at oil temperatures around $90^\circ\text{C}$ to $110^\circ\text{C}$.
- The Benefits: This low temperature prevents the Maillard reaction from darkening the veggie, preserving the vibrant green hue. Crucially, oil absorption is reduced by up to $50\%$ compared to atmospheric frying, and acrylamide formation (a potential carcinogen found in burnt starches) is virtually eliminated.
2. Freeze-Drying and Dehydration
For an entirely oil-free option, some premium broccoli crisps are made via industrial dehydration or lyophilization (freeze-drying).
- The Process: Flash-frozen broccoli is placed in a vacuum chamber where the ambient temperature is slowly raised under a deep vacuum. This causes the ice crystals within the vegetable's cellular structure to sublimate directly from a solid to a gas, bypassing the liquid phase entirely.
- The Benefits: This preserves the exact spatial geometry of the floret. The resulting snack is incredibly lightweight and brittle, possessing an intense, concentrated broccoli flavor with zero added fats.

The Art of the Homemade Broccoli Crisp
For the culinary enthusiast, replicating the satisfying crunch of commercial snacks at home is a rewarding endeavor. While home kitchens lack vacuum fryers, alternative binding agents can turn fresh broccoli into savory, low-carb crisps that rival any store-bought alternative.
The secret to successful homemade broccoli crisps lies in moisture management and structural reinforcement. Because broccoli is composed of roughly $89\%$ water, baking it directly without a binder usually results in charred, limp pieces rather than a cohesive crisp. By using an egg binder and finely grated hard cheeses like Parmesan, the proteins and fats create a lattice that crisps up beautifully in a standard oven.
The Ultimate 4-Ingredient Broccoli Parmesan Crisp Recipe
Ingredients:
- 300g Fresh broccoli florets (stems removed)
- 100g Parmigiano-Reggiano or sharp white cheddar (finely grated)
- 1 Large egg (whisked)
- 5g Garlic powder and cracked black pepper (to taste)
Methodological Execution:
- Thermal Processing: Steam the broccoli florets for 4 minutes until vibrant green and slightly tender. Do not overcook, as this breaks down the structural pectin.
- Desiccation (Crucial Step): Transfer the steamed broccoli to a clean kitchen towel. Wrap it tightly and wring out as much water as humanly possible. The drier the pulp, the crunchier the final crisp.
- Maceration and Blending: Finely chop the dried broccoli until it reaches a rice-like consistency. In a mixing bowl, combine the broccoli pulp, grated cheese, whisked egg, and spices. Mix thoroughly until a cohesive dough forms.
- Formatting: Line a heavy-duty baking sheet with premium parchment paper. Scoop tablespoon-sized portions of the mixture onto the sheet. Using the bottom of a flat glass or a spatula, press each mound down until it is paper-thin (roughly $2\text{mm}$ thickness).
- Baking: Place in a preheated oven at $200^\circ\text{C}$ ($392^\circ\text{F}$) for 15 to 18 minutes. Monitor closely; the edges should turn a deep amber brown.
- Cooling and Setting: Remove from the oven and let them rest on the tray for 5 to 10 minutes. As the melted cheese cools, it solidifies into a rigid, shatteringly crisp structure.
Comparative Analysis: Broccoli Crisps vs. Traditional Snacks
To truly appreciate the value proposition of broccoli crisps, one must analyze how they perform against mainstream snacking options. Consumers often assume that anything labeled "veggie" is inherently superior, but a cold analytical look at nutrition facts reveals the real nuances.
The table below provides a macro-level comparison based on a standard $28\text{g}$ (1 oz) serving across four popular snack categories:
| Nutritional Metric (per 28g serving) | Vacuum-Dried Broccoli Crisps | Standard Potato Chips | Baked Tortilla Chips | Kale Chips (Nacho Style) |
| Calories | 120–130 | 150–160 | 130–140 | 130–150 |
| Total Fat | 4g – 6g | 10g – 11g | 6g – 7g | 7g – 9g |
| Net Carbohydrates | 10g – 12g | 14g – 15g | 18g – 20g | 6g – 8g |
| Dietary Fiber | 4g – 5g | 1g | 1.5g | 3g |
| Protein | 3g – 4g | 2g | 2g | 4g – 5g |
| Sodium | 120mg | 170mg | 150mg | 220mg |
| Vitamin C (% DV) | ~40% | ~6% | 0% | ~80% |
Analytical Takeaways
From this data, it becomes evident that genuine broccoli crisps drastically outperform potato and tortilla chips regarding dietary fiber. A single serving provides nearly $20\%$ of the recommended daily intake of fiber, which slows digestion, prevents blood sugar spikes, and promotes prolonged satiety. Furthermore, their fat content is significantly lower than that of traditional potato chips, making them a dense source of micronutrients without an excess calorie load.
Culinary Applications: Beyond the Snack Bag
While broccoli crisps are exceptional when eaten plain, their structural integrity and concentrated flavor profile render them highly versatile ingredients in modern gastronomy. Chefs and creative home cooks are utilizing them to add texture and depth to various dishes.
1. The Ultimate Gluten-Free Breading Alternative
Traditional fried foods rely on breadcrumbs (panko) for texture. For those tracking carbohydrates or managing celiac disease, crushed broccoli crisps offer a revolutionary coating alternative.
- Application: Pulverize a bag of savory broccoli crisps in a food processor until they reach a coarse crumb texture. Dredge chicken breast strips or tofu blocks in egg wash, coat them thoroughly in the crisp crumbs, and air-fry at $190^\circ\text{C}$. The result is an incredibly crunchy, vibrant green crust that infuses the protein with a nutty, roasted vegetable flavor.
2. Textural Contrasts for Soups and Salads
Croutons add satisfying crunch to salads and creamy soups, but they are nutritionally hollow.
- Application: Floating whole vacuum-fried broccoli crisps on top of a velvety roasted cauliflower soup or a classic potato leek soup adds an elegant, functional garnish. In salads, swapping out croutons for broccoli crisps elevates the fiber content while introducing an unexpected aesthetic element.
3. The Modern Charcuterie Board
The modern charcuterie board has evolved beyond simple meat and cheese. Incorporating vibrant, structurally sound vessels for dips is key. Broccoli crisps pair exceptionally well with:
- Hummus and Baba Ganoush: The earthiness of sesame tahini complements the brassica notes of the crisp.
- Greek Yogurt Labneh: A tart, strained yogurt dip seasoned with lemon zest and sumac cuts through the richness of baked or fried vegetable chips beautifully.

Agricultural Impact and Upcycling
One of the most compelling aspects of the broccoli crisp industry is its potential to mitigate food waste through agricultural upcycling. In fresh produce retail, broccoli heads must meet strict cosmetic standards regarding size, color, and symmetry. Millions of pounds of broccoli stalks and slightly asymmetrical florets are discarded annually at the farm level because they fail to meet fresh-market criteria.
Processors specializing in broccoli crisps can utilize these "ugly" or surplus crops. Because the raw material is destined to be chopped, pureed, or vacuum-fried, its initial visual symmetry is irrelevant. By upcycling these sub-optimal yields into premium, high-margin snacks, manufacturers contribute to a more sustainable agricultural supply chain, reducing farm-level economic loss and minimizing greenhouse gas emissions associated with food decomposition in landfills.
Challenges in Scaling
Despite its bright future, the industry faces distinct hurdles:
- Cost of Production: Advanced manufacturing setups like industrial vacuum fryers and freeze-dryers carry immense capital expenditure costs compared to standard atmospheric continuous fryers. Consequently, premium broccoli crisps often command a higher retail price per ounce than mass-market potato chips.
- Flavor Engineering: Broccoli possesses volatile sulfur compounds that can become overly pungent if the raw material is processed incorrectly. Striking the balance between preserving nutrients and minimizing overly aggressive sulfur notes requires precise temperature controls and meticulous curing processes.
